Foundation Pouring in Fort Worth, TX
Foundation pouring services involve the process of creating a solid base for residential and commercial structures by placing concrete into prepared excavations. This service is essential for new construction projects, including homes, garages, additions, and small commercial buildings. Property owners typically seek foundation pouring to ensure stability and durability, especially in areas prone to soil movement or shifting. Before requesting this service, it’s important to understand the type of foundation suitable for the property, such as slab, crawl space, or basement, and to consider factors like soil conditions, drainage, and local building codes.
Homeowners should also be aware of the importance of proper site preparation and the potential need for reinforcement, such as rebar or wire mesh, to enhance strength. Clarifying the scope of work, including excavation, form setting, and curing processes, can help ensure the project meets expectations. Understanding the timeline and any necessary permits or inspections can also facilitate a smooth foundation pouring process, providing a stable base for the entire structure.

Common Foundation Pouring Jobs
Foundation Pouring - Essential for creating a stable base for new structures or additions.
Basement Foundations - Provides a strong foundation for underground levels in residential or commercial buildings.
Slab Foundations - Common for single-story homes, offering a flat, durable base for construction.
Pier and Beam Foundations - Suitable for areas with expansive soil, elevating the structure above ground level.
Retaining Wall Foundations - Supports retaining walls to prevent soil erosion and manage landscape grading.
Foundation Repair Pouring - Used to address settling or cracking issues by reinforcing or replacing existing foundations.
Foundation Pouring Questions
What types of projects require foundation pouring? Foundation pouring is typically needed for new construction, additions, or significant repairs to ensure stability and support for structures.
How is the foundation pouring process typically performed? The process involves preparing the site, setting forms, reinforcing with steel, and pouring concrete in a controlled manner to create a solid base.
What should property owners know about foundation materials? Concrete is the standard material used for pouring foundations due to its durability and strength.
Are there specific considerations for foundation pouring in Fort Worth, TX? Local soil conditions and climate can influence foundation design and methods used to ensure long-term stability.
